- The intervention consisted of a one-hour face-to-face session with 15 minutes of didactic content followed by 45 minutes of discussion. — Evaluation of an education intervention to support genomics research participation: a community-based pre–post study among participants under-represented in diabetes genomics research
- The education content covered genetics fundamentals, genebank purpose, procedures, benefits, and risks needed for future genomic study consent. — Evaluation of an education intervention to support genomics research participation: a community-based pre–post study among participants under-represented in diabetes genomics research
- Scripps Health partnered with Project Dulce to develop a culturally tailored genomics education intervention for Hispanic/Latino adults with diabetes-related conditions. — Evaluation of an education intervention to support genomics research participation: a community-based pre–post study among participants under-represented in diabetes genomics research
- The study used a single-arm cohort pre/post survey design at Federally Qualified Health Centers in San Diego. — Evaluation of an education intervention to support genomics research participation: a community-based pre–post study among participants under-represented in diabetes genomics research
- Visual materials with minimal text were used to accommodate varied literacy levels. — Evaluation of an education intervention to support genomics research participation: a community-based pre–post study among participants under-represented in diabetes genomics research
- Community members contributed to the intervention materials and survey instrument under community-engaged research principles. — Evaluation of an education intervention to support genomics research participation: a community-based pre–post study among participants under-represented in diabetes genomics research
